For women who are avid skiers, staying warm and dry means purchasing ski jackets that offer resistance to icy winds and protection from dampness. Women's ski jackets should have a relatively high level of insulation without making the fabric feel bulky or inhibiting movement. Other features can include sturdy zippers, hems and cuffs adjustable in length with several lined pockets.

Ski Jackets for Women
One of the most popular styles in ski jackets for women are those with an inner shell similar to a vest with a zipper closure and a layered outer shell that also zips for extra warmth. The necklines on the inner shell are a mock turtleneck style while in some styles, the neckline on the outer jacket completely covers to just below the chin. Added features of women's ski jackets are snap closure panels over the zipper tracking, detachable hoods that snap at the back and sides of the neck of the jacket and a pocket especially sized for a cell phone. The hoods on these ski jackets may be lined in fleece that snap to keep the hood stationary when not in use.
Fabric features of women's ski jackets may be an outer layer of durable waterproof nylon for the basic shell. Other fabrics may be goose down with a quilted design and a polyester or tricot lining over the goose down lofting. Some ski jackets for women have an outer fabric layer of nylon ripstop material. One especially nice feature that may be included are heat packs that are built into pockets of these jackets. One other attractive feature in some styles is a zippered chest pocket above the waist. This is especially handy for tucking an extra pair of gloves or handkerchief for quick access while on the slopes.
Some ski jackets for women have Velcro attached to the outer sleeve and gloves that grip the Velcro strip to create a complete seal between jacket and gloves. This feature is well appreciated as it prevents loss of a glove while skiing. The slashed pockets on the sides of the ski jacket are large enough to store a small water bottle or a woolen ski cap and sunglasses.These ski jackets are available in a broad range of colors and size to meet most any skier's preferences.
It's important to insure that a safe body temperature is maintained while skiing. Check the labels on some ski jackets. They may include a temperature advisory that will provide the lowest mean temperature in which to wear the jacket with relative warmth. If this isn't included in the label, check the manufacturer's leaflet that is usually available at the time of sale. Or, inquire with the sales clerk at time of purchase.
